Output 936964803cd51c93dc99620d5d513a6c10f862af6db5cc7eb3e4f849de110d34:6

value
625558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f825a24a5a75c81f832ef764e52fa48b909fc210 OP_EQUAL
address
3QK6ayDwP7FNEoQoGYBFqAK8qmbrhng7EU
transaction
936964803cd51c93dc99620d5d513a6c10f862af6db5cc7eb3e4f849de110d34
spent
true